About Robyn Ott

Robyn Ott is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) with 30 years of clinical experience, including 28 years working in private practice, and is based in Arkansas. She works with individuals and families across a wide range of concerns, including stress, anxiety, trauma and abuse, self-esteem, depression, coping with life changes, relationship and family issues, grief, intimacy-related concerns, eating and sleeping difficulties, parenting and fatherhood matters, anger, career questions, coaching, compassion fatigue, and ADHD. Her additional focus areas include abandonment, aging and geriatric issues, blended family dynamics, body image, caregiver stress, codependency, commitment challenges, communication and control issues, responses to natural or human-caused disasters, dependent personality patterns, divorce and separation, and family of origin problems.

She integrates a variety of therapeutic approaches to tailor care to each person’s needs, drawing on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), Client-Centered Therapy,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), Emotionally-Focused Therapy (EFT), Imago Relationship Therapy, Mindfulness-based methods, Solution-Focused Therapy, and Trauma-Focused Therapy. This mix supports both symptom relief and practical skill building for everyday challenges.

Robyn’s style emphasizes patience, directness, and compassion, paired with practical tools and real-world strategies. A strength-focused orientation guides her work, helping people identify and use their existing abilities to address long-standing patterns. She often employs goal-directed techniques, pacing, incremental goal setting, and accountability to help clients clarify and sustain meaningful change. Throughout her career she has offered consistent, experience-informed guidance intended to foster greater confidence, resilience, and hope.

Could Virtual Therapy Be a Good Fit for You?

Many people ask whether online therapy can deliver meaningful support. For a range of common concerns - such as stress, an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, or navigating life transitions - online therapy has been shown to be just as effective as traditional in-person sessions.

One of the primary advantages is flexibility. Individuals can connect with a therapist using the mode that works best for them, whether through video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or in-app messaging. This flexibility makes it easier to integrate therapeutic work into a busy schedule and to maintain continuity during life changes.

Therapists who provide online care are licensed professionals, and many people appreciate the ability to change therapists if they are seeking a different fit. For those weighing whether virtual therapy is appropriate, considering factors like communication preferences, scheduling needs, and the type of support sought can help determine the best approach.
